#pragma once
#include <ATen/ATen.h>
#include "../macros.h"
namespace vision {
namespace ops {
VISION_API at::Tensor deform_conv2d(
const at::Tensor& input,
const at::Tensor& weight,
const at::Tensor& offset,
const at::Tensor& mask,
const at::Tensor& bias,
int64_t stride_h,
int64_t stride_w,
int64_t pad_h,
int64_t pad_w,
int64_t dilation_h,
int64_t dilation_w,
int64_t groups,
int64_t offset_groups,
bool use_mask);
VISION_API at::Tensor deform_conv2d_symint(
const at::Tensor& input,
const at::Tensor& weight,
const at::Tensor& offset,
const at::Tensor& mask,
const at::Tensor& bias,
c10::SymInt stride_h,
c10::SymInt stride_w,
c10::SymInt pad_h,
c10::SymInt pad_w,
c10::SymInt dilation_h,
c10::SymInt dilation_w,
c10::SymInt groups,
c10::SymInt offset_groups,
bool use_mask);
namespace detail {
std::tuple<at::Tensor, at::Tensor, at::Tensor, at::Tensor, at::Tensor>
_deform_conv2d_backward(
const at::Tensor& grad,
const at::Tensor& input,
const at::Tensor& weight,
const at::Tensor& offset,
const at::Tensor& mask,
const at::Tensor& bias,
int64_t stride_h,
int64_t stride_w,
int64_t pad_h,
int64_t pad_w,
int64_t dilation_h,
int64_t dilation_w,
int64_t groups,
int64_t offset_groups,
bool use_mask);
std::tuple<at::Tensor, at::Tensor, at::Tensor, at::Tensor, at::Tensor>
_deform_conv2d_backward_symint(
const at::Tensor& grad,
const at::Tensor& input,
const at::Tensor& weight,
const at::Tensor& offset,
const at::Tensor& mask,
const at::Tensor& bias,
c10::SymInt stride_h,
c10::SymInt stride_w,
c10::SymInt pad_h,
c10::SymInt pad_w,
c10::SymInt dilation_h,
c10::SymInt dilation_w,
c10::SymInt groups,
c10::SymInt offset_groups,
bool use_mask);
} // namespace detail
} // namespace ops
} // namespace vision
